Born in Philadelphia on July 10, 1938, Lee Morgan's

career lasted from the mid-1950s to the early

1970s. Originally interested in the vibraphone, he

eventually showed a growing enthusiasm for the

trumpet. His primary stylistic influence was Clifford

Brown, who gave the teenager a few lessons before

his untimely death in a car accident. Morgan joined

the Dizzy Gillespie big band at 18, and remained a

member for a year and a half, until the group was

forced to disband in 1958. He began his recording

career as a leader in 1956 for the Blue Note label. He

would record a total of 25 albums for the company.

Morgan joined Art Blakey's Jazz Messengers in 1958,

where he further developed his talents as a soloist

and composer. Blakey is heard along with Morgan

in Expoobident, presented here, which features a

strong hard bop quintet that also includes Eddie

Higgins on piano, Art Davis on bass, and Clifford

Jordan on tenor saxophone. Morgan's death was

tragic. On the evening of February 19, 1972, he was

shot by his girlfriend following an argument between

sets at Slug's, a popular New York City jazz club. He

was only 33.

LEE MORGAN, trumpet

CLIFFORD JORDAN, tenor sax

EDDIE HIGGINS, piano

ART DAVIS, bass

ART BLAKEY, drums

Chicago, October 13, 1960.

Clifford Jordan out on A2.

Original session produced by Sid McCoy.

*BONUS TRACK:

LEE MORGAN, trumpet; BOBBY TIMMONS, piano;

JYMIE MERRITT, bass; ART BLAKEY, drums.

Paris, France, December 18 or 19, 1958.

[From the soundtrack to the film Des Femmes Disparaissent.]
